Chicago is one of America’s great cities, renowned for its world-class architecture, vibrant cultural scene, and mouthwatering deep-dish pizza. As the third largest city in the United States, Chicago offers visitors endless attractions and activities.

Art lovers can spend days wandering the Art Institute of Chicago and Museum of Contemporary Art. Foodies indulge in Michelin-starred restaurants and local classics like the Chicago-style hot dog. And no trip is complete without admiring the city’s iconic skyline from the waterfront or the top of the 108-story Willis Tower.
